Output d35be595deff8070862f446923f31d20ccdaf3f70b307a10d1348142a1db772c:16

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fc096b262431803a6b90a0ec77d1066362d6568 OP_EQUAL
address
38xi1zYiYBvjK5FS6Z9CCXBa5QGDpDV8tC
transaction
d35be595deff8070862f446923f31d20ccdaf3f70b307a10d1348142a1db772c
spent
true